Translation: The Knowledge of Tassawuf is a branch from the sciences of Shariah that
originated within the Umma from beginning, their way is the way of truth (haqq) and guidance
(Hidaya) adopted by the great early Muslims (salaf), Imams, the Sahaba (Ridhwan Allaho
Ajmain) their followers (Tabiyeen) and those who came after them. The approach
is based upon constant application of worship, complete devotion to Allah, aversion to the false
splendor of the world, abstinence from pleasure, property, and position to which the great mass
aspire, and retirement from the world into solitude for divine worship
. This was the norm of Sahaba and Islaaf, however when worldly aspirations increased in the
second century and after, but those dedicated to worship came to be known as Sufiya or People
of Tassawuf.

Translation: Narrated by Abu Zakriyyah bin Abi Ishaq who said that he went to the gathering of
Abul Hassan bin Samoon (rah) where a person asked him: What is Tassawuf?,
He replied: It has a name and also reality, which of the two have you asked about?
The questioner said: Both, He replied:
In name it means to forget the world and its residents (i.e. dedicate yourself only to
Allah),
whereas the reality of it is to deal nicely with creation, not to harm them and also to share their
pain for the sake of Allah.

Translation: The Sufi training is a religious one. It is free from any reprehensible
intentions. They aspire to total concentration upon Allah with a direct
approach towards him so that they also get the zawq as attained by knowers of Allah and his
Tawhid (Ahlul Irfan wa-tawhid). This is why to create an accord in their thoughts they keep
themselves hungry in order to flourish their soul in remembrance of Allah and thus attain
success in achieving their goals, because when the soul feeds on Dhikr (of Allah) it attains
knowledge and closeness to Him, but if it is far from Dhikr (of Allah) then Shaytan becomes
dominant upon it.....
Whatever knowledge of the unseen and Tassaruf attained (by Sufis) is not what they intended
for originally. Had it been intentional then the devotion of Sufis would have been directed toward
something other than Allah, namely toward knowing unseen and get Tassaruf. What a losing
business that would have been! In reality, it would have been Shirk. Some (Sufis) said:
Whosoever tried to attain Marifah for the sake of Marifah (committed shirk), this is why their
devotion is only (to come near) the Master, and nothing else.

Translation:Abul Abbas bin Ata (rah) narrates: Some backbiter complained about Sufis to
the Caliph that these people are zindeeq and those who have departed from the religion,
hence Abul Hassan Thawri (rah), Abu Hamza (rah) and Riqam (rah) were captured, and Junaid
got busy in fiqh as he used to do kalaam on the way of Abu Thawr (rah). These people were
presented infront of the Caliph of that time who ordered them to be killed. Abul Hassan quickly
came infront of the Jallad so that he is the one to be killed first.. The Jallad asked him: What

happened, Why did you come ahead from amongst all? He (Abul Hasan) replied: I have given
preference to my friends so that they live a little more than me. The Jallad became amazed
upon looking at the Isaar (of these Sufis) and refused to kill anyone of them, he was amazed
from the one and also all of them.
...He wrote a letter to the caliph and sent their case to the Qadhi ul Qudha who was Ismail bin
Ishaq (rah). Even in the court Abul Hasan Thawri (rah) came ahead first. The Judge asked him
about the Usool of Deen, Faraid, Taharah and Salaat. He (Abul Hasan) gave (perfect) answers
to all and said: after these usool and faraid there are special people of Allah who get food and
drink by Allah who hear with (his hearing) and He is the one who answers for them. When the
Qadhi heard his speech he wept profoundly and went to the Caliph and said: If these
people have departed from religion and are zindeeq then there is no Mawhid on the face
of this earth.

Translation: Abul Qasim al-Khazzaz and It is also said Al-Qawairi, in reality he was from
Nahawand, born and grew young in Baghdad, heard ahadith from Al Hussain bin Arfa (rah) and
got the knowledge of Fiqh from Abul Thawr Ibrahim bin Khalid Kalbi (rah) and in his presence at
the age of about 20 he started to give verdicts. We have mentioned him in Tabaqat al
Shafiyyah. He was student of Siri Saqti (rah) and Harith al-Muhasibi (rah) which made him
attain a lot of fame. He was firm in worship due to which Allah opened doors
of many uloom upon him and he talked about the tariqa of Sufiya.
It was his norm that he used to pray 300 Rakaat everyday and recite 30,000 Tasbihat and for 40
years he did not sleep on (soft) bed, due to such deeds Allah granted him beneficial knowledge
along with correct implementation in a way that nobody else in his time had acquired. He knew
all the branches of Uloom very well to the extent that he left no shortcoming in whatever matter
he talked about, rather he used to explain every single ruling in such many ways that no other
alim could have done.
Same was his situation in (uloom) of Tassawuf.
